The UNCHAIN project revolutionizes urban logistics

ABSTRACT
UNCHAIN, R&I project funded by the European Community, aims to revolutionize last-mile urban logistics by creating a set of services and activities, tested and validated in 3 living labs and 4 follower cities.

Challenge
One of UNCHAIN’s three living labs is the historic center of Florence. The PUMS highlights the need to reduce and better manage the number of last-mile delivery vehicles entering the city center and emphasizes the importance of optimizing the use of time and urban space. The Florence living lab focuses on the historic center, aiming to improve traffic congestion, waiting times, and urban maintenance.
Approach
A key part of UNCHAIN’s mission is to break down data silos and promote data sharing and interoperability between public and private sectors. Moreover, through collaboration between public authorities and logistics stakeholders, UNCHAIN introduces a range of services, including decision-support tools for land-use strategies, Sustainable Urban Logistics Plans (SULP), and Urban Vehicle Access Regulations (UVAR). These data-driven solutions optimize the planning and operation of Urban Consolidation Centers (UCC) and loading/unloading zones, paving the way for improved urban logistics.

Solution
Digital Ecosystem
Innovative services have been developed to support and enhance policy-making and urban planning. Specifically: - Fast and agile tools for cities and operators to digitize the permitting process for access, transit, and parking; - Monitoring, analysis, and reporting tools to track real-time and historical usage of loading/unloading areas; - Info Parking and Parking Guidance systems to provide logistics operators with visibility of available and occupied parking spots, guidance to reach the selected loading/unloading zone as quickly as possible, and alerts on maximum parking time; - Incentive systems to track operator behavior and reward the most sustainable practices.
Results

More efficient loading and unloading zones through better planning

Less street congestion

More efficient deliveries and new delivery services
